For XVid, check out Smart Movie. It costs a couple of quid, but it's an excellent product. It'll play DivX and XVid and comes with a PC-based convertor for optimising and resizing your videos for playback on your phone. For playing mp3s, I would assume that its already possible through the bundled Real Player app. If not, then check out Ultra MP3 or OggPlay. |
